fix: preserve pinned field during JSONL import (bd-phtv)

Fixed two code paths where pinned=false from JSONL would overwrite
existing pinned=true in database:
- importer.go: Only update pinned if explicitly true in JSONL
- multirepo.go: Use COALESCE to preserve existing pinned value

Added tests for pinned field preservation.

Note: Bug may have additional code path - investigation ongoing.

// TestImportPreservesPinnedField tests that importing from JSONL (which has omitempty
// for the pinned field) does NOT reset an existing pinned=true issue to pinned=false.
//
// Bug scenario (bd-phtv):
// 1. User runs `bd pin <issue-id>` which sets pinned=true in SQLite
// 2. Any subsequent bd command (e.g., `bd show`) triggers auto-import from JSONL
// 3. JSONL has pinned=false due to omitempty (field absent means false in Go)
// 4. Import overwrites pinned=true with pinned=false, losing the pinned state
//
// Expected: Import should preserve existing pinned=true when incoming pinned=false
// (since false just means "field was absent in JSONL due to omitempty").

// Pinned field fix (bd-phtv): Use COALESCE(NULLIF(?, 0), pinned) to preserve
// existing pinned=1 when incoming pinned=0 (which means field was absent in
// JSONL due to omitempty). This prevents auto-import from resetting pinned issues.
